To understand why house insurance is important, we must first examine the brief origin of home insurance. Did you know that home insurance evolved from “fire insurance”? As the name says, fire insurance was designed to protect against fires, but it has now evolved to the concept of “home insurance” as it now covers more.

Home insurance covers various benefits.

1. Protection for your Finances

One of the benefits of home insurance is for a third party to cover expenditures incurred when anything unexpected or unintentional occurs to your home and/or valuables. It means you’ll be financially protected against losses caused by theft, fire, wind damage, and other disasters. If anything happens to your house, your typical policy may provide coverage for the building, personal possessions, and additional living expenses.

2. Protection Against Third-party Liability

Home insurance protects more than simply your house. Another benefit of home insurance is that it can also help if someone is hurt on your property, or if you damage someone else’s property or harm someone by accident. Liability coverage on home insurance can assist minimize financial troubles by shielding homeowners from lawsuits for property damage and injury caused by carelessness. It can assist pay a guest’s medical bills if he or she is hurt on your property and submits a medical bill to the insurance provider. It does not, however, entail covering the homeowner’s and his or her family’s medical expenditures.

How to Get Insurance for Your Home?

Purchasing a home insurance coverage is typically an afterthought when compared to all the research, work, and energy that goes into acquiring a property. However, homes insurance requires more careful analysis because the appropriate coverage might save you money if a significant disaster happens.

1. Know Your Needs

It can be tough to choose the appropriate coverage for your needs, especially because there is no one-size-fits-all answer. Selecting a benefit may not necessarily reduce the cost of your house insurance, but it will assist safeguard your home in the event of an unanticipated event. Moreover, estimating the cost of replacing your house and possessions if they were damaged or destroyed may assist you in determining the appropriate level of coverage you’ll need.

2. Inquire on Company’s Reputation

Remember that the largest firm is not always the greatest company. Keep in mind that large insurance carriers with a huge, strong name may not be the appropriate insurance carrier for your specific needs. Learn how the organization has been functioning for years. Join Facebook groups or ask family and friends if they know of any firms that fit your needs.

3. Compare Prices

Each house insurance business has its own pricing. Comparing quotes from many companies for the same level of coverage will assist you in determining which home insurance company is the most affordable for you.
